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en el código postal 85326
Cuánto cuestan los alquileres más amplios de tres y cuatro dormitorios en 85326?
Para quienes buscan una vivienda más grande, los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en 85326 oscilan entre $1,633 hasta $2,675, mientras que las casas con tres dormitorios,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ler oscilan entre $1,100 hasta $7,725. Los alquileres de viviendas unifamiliares de cuatro dormitorios también están disponibles a partir de $1,699 y los apartamentos de cuatro dormitorios comienzan en $1,699.
